]> git.apps.os.sepia.ceph.com Git - ceph.git/commitdiff
mds/Locker: do not ack from do_cap_update
authorSage Weil <sage@redhat.com>
Wed, 2 Sep 2015 02:14:27 +0000 (22:14 -0400)
committerSage Weil <sage@redhat.com>
Thu, 1 Oct 2015 13:42:35 +0000 (09:42 -0400)
Caller (handle_client_caps) already does it if we return
false.

Signed-off-by: Sage Weil <sage@redhat.com>
src/mds/Locker.cc

index e1f5067a866dd1f05c536a91633afc613d9efb6d..0cbb5e3982dfbe9543702e92d907b9cfe4948a87 100644 (file)
@@ -3134,8 +3134,6 @@ bool Locker::_do_cap_update(CInode *in, Capability *cap,
   Session *session = static_cast<Session *>(m->get_connection()->get_priv());
   if (!session->check_access(in, MAY_WRITE, m->caller_uid, m->caller_gid, 0, 0)) {
     dout(10) << "check_access failed, dropping cap update on " << *in << dendl;
-    if (ack)
-      mds->send_message_client_counted(ack, client);
     return false;
   }
   session->put();